Dropdown Question

The Dropdown question allows respondents to select a single option from a predefined list. Dropdowns are ideal when you have multiple answer choices and want to keep the form clean and organized.

This question type works well for:

  • Country, city, or region selection
  • Favorite items, categories, or preferences
  • Any multiple-choice question with many options

The Config tab on the right-hand panel allows you to:

Enable the Required toggle to prevent respondents from skipping this question.

  • Randomize – Shuffles the order of options each time the form is displayed.
  • Alphabetical Order – Sorts options alphabetically.

  • Keep option lists concise to avoid overwhelming respondents.
  • Alphabetize or randomize when order matters or to avoid bias.
  • Use Dropdowns instead of multiple-choice when you have many options to save space.
  • For longer lists, consider combining with search-enabled Dropdowns (if supported) for better usability.
